French aviation industrialist and founder of Dassault Aviation.
Born January 22, 1892 in Paris as Marcel Bloch. Served as an aircraft designer and manufacturer during World War I. After World War II, adopted the name Dassault and founded Société des Avions Marcel Dassault. Pioneered the development of iconic fighter jets such as the Mirage series and business jets like the Falcon. Advanced innovations in aerodynamics, materials, and jet propulsion. Under his leadership, Dassault Aviation became a global aerospace leader. Also served in the French National Assembly, influencing postwar industrial policy. He died in 1986, leaving a lasting legacy in aviation.
